Motion Parallax
A depth cue in visual perception where objects closer to the viewer move faster across the visual field than objects further away.
Binocular Disparity
The difference in the visual images on the retinae of the two eyes that provides an important cue for depth perception.
Linear Perspective
A depth cue that parallel lines appear to converge in the distance and objects appear smaller as their distance from the observer increases, contributing to the perception of depth.
Apparent Convergence
The perception of two parallel lines appearing to come together at a distance.
